Question:
(a) Suppose that 100 tires made by Bridgestone last on average 21,819 miles with a standard deviation of 1,295 miles. Test the null hypothesis µ = 22, 000 miles against the alternative hypothesis µ < 22, 000 miles at the 5% level of con?dence.
(b) It is decided that H0 is rejected if the sample mean is less than 21,819. Using the same information in part (a) above, except for the 5% level of con?dence, calculate
(i) P(H0 is accepted | H1 is true with µ = 21, 500).(ii) the power of the test.
(c) The results of 100 students who have taken part in examinations on Probability and Statistics during the past few years can be summarised as follows. Out of 42 males, 30 have passed and out of 58 females, only 34 have passed. Test at the 5% signi?cance level whether there is a relationship between gender and success in modules of Probability and Statistics.
